Because the book wasn't made with your rifle. Throat, chamber, internal barrel dia. choice of powder primer and bullets can all affect your pressure and velocity.

I have some loads that are maxed out 1-2 grains below "book", and others that are maxed out a few grains above. I can swing my velocities 200 fps just by changing primers and brass, and in some instances adjusted my powder charges accordingly.
